Gangaur Festival of Rajasthan: Celebrating the Divine Union of Shiva and Parvati (Gauri)

Introduction: Rajasthan, the vibrant land of royal traditions and rich cultural heritage, celebrates numerous colorful festivals. Among them, the Gangaur festival holds a special place, honoring the divine union of Shiva and Parvati (Gauri). This blog post explores the enchanting features of the Gangaur festival, highlighting its significance and the cities in Rajasthan where it is celebrated with great pomp and splendor.

  1. A Cultural Extravaganza: Gangaur is celebrated with unmatched zeal and enthusiasm throughout Rajasthan, but certain cities witness grand festivities on an exceptional scale. Jaipur, Udaipur, Jodhpur, Bikaner, and Nathdwara are prominent locations where the festival is celebrated in a grand manner. These cities become the hub of cultural extravaganzas, attracting both locals and tourists to witness the grandeur of Gangaur.
  2. Reverence for Shiva and Parvati: Gangaur is primarily a women-centric festival dedicated to the worship of the divine couple, Shiva and Parvati. It holds great significance for married women seeking blessings for marital bliss and the long life of their husbands. Unmarried girls also participate, seeking suitable life partners. The festival embodies reverence for the divine feminine and the essence of love and devotion in relationships.
  3. Rituals and Customs: The festivities commence on the day following Holi and continue for 18 days. Women dress in traditional attire, adorning themselves with colorful Rajasthani jewelry. They gracefully balance beautifully decorated clay pots, known as “ghudlias,” on their heads, symbolizing the divine presence of Parvati. These pots contain germinating seeds and are illuminated by oil lamps.
  4. Processions and Cultural Performances: The highlight of the Gangaur festival is the grand procession that meanders through the streets of Rajasthan’s cities. The procession features exquisitely adorned idols of Shiva and Parvati, lovingly carried by devotees on their heads. Musicians, folk dancers, and performers contribute to the festive fervor, captivating onlookers with their traditional music and dance forms, such as Ghoomar and Kalbelia.
  5. Offerings to the Divine Couple: Devotees present elaborate offerings to Shiva and Parvati during the Gangaur festival. Women prepare traditional sweets like ghewar and goond ke laddu, along with other delicacies. These offerings are placed before the idols of Shiva and Parvati as a symbol of gratitude and devotion. Married women observe a fast, abstaining from food and water until they have performed the rituals and spotted the moon.
  6. Cultural Showcase: The Gangaur festival serves as a magnificent platform to showcase Rajasthan’s rich cultural heritage. Artisans and craftsmen proudly display their traditional artwork, including intricately designed handicrafts, textiles, and jewelry. Folk music and dance performances, puppet shows, and traditional games are organized, offering visitors a glimpse into the vibrant culture of the state.

Celebrating Diversity: Gangaur Festival of Rajasthan Captivating Foreign Visitors

Foreigners too come to witness the Gangaur festival in Rajasthan. The cultural richness and unique traditions associated with the festival attract tourists from all over the world. Rajasthan, with its vibrant colors, grand processions, traditional music and dance performances, and the aura of devotion, offers a captivating experience for visitors.

The Gangaur festival provides an opportunity for foreigners to immerse themselves in the cultural heritage of Rajasthan. It allows them to witness the rituals, customs, and vibrant celebrations associated with the festival firsthand. Many tourists are intrigued by the devotion and reverence displayed during the festival, as well as the elaborate decorations, traditional attire, and the lively atmosphere that engulfs the cities during this time.

Foreign visitors often participate in the processions, dance along with the folk performers, try traditional Rajasthani cuisine, and engage with the local communities to understand the significance of the festival. The beauty and uniqueness of the Gangaur festival make it a popular attraction for those seeking an authentic cultural experience in Rajasthan.

The tourism industry in Rajasthan recognizes the importance of the Gangaur festival and organizes various cultural events and activities to cater to the interests of foreign tourists. Special tours, cultural shows, and workshops are organized during this time, allowing visitors to learn more about the festival’s history, traditions, and artistic heritage.
